Rosalia is a CDP located in Butler County, Kansas. Rosalia has a 2025 population of 147 . Rosalia is currently declining at a rate of -1.34% annually but its population has increased by 47%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 100 in 2020.
The average household income in Rosalia is $162,944 with a poverty rate of 15.08%. The median age in Rosalia is 29.5 years: 28.8 years for males, and 29.5 years for females. For every 100 females there are 84.5 males.
